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Slab: Larger slabs require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Thickness: Thicker slabs are more durable but require more concrete, which raises the price.
  • Material Quality: Higher-grade concrete and reinforcements can enhance durability but will cost more.
  • Labor Costs: Skilled labor in Sterling, VA may charge different rates based on experience and demand.
  • Site Preparation: The condition of the site can affect costs; uneven or difficult terrain may require additional work.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the expense.
  •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can impact the timeline and cost due to potential delays or additional measures needed for proper curing.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Description Average Cost (Sterling, VA)
Basic Concrete Slab (4-inch thick) $5 - $8 per square foot
Reinforced Concrete Slab $7 - $10 per square foot
Site Preparation $1,000 - $2,500
Concrete Delivery $100 - $150 per cubic yard
Labor $50 - $75 per hour
Permits and Inspections $200 - $500
